Transaction 51399897375c9920c2c86bb4d2b2dd5ec8635e2244ec2a245d9177d0fcb80b82
1 Input
1 Output
-
51399897375c9920c2c86bb4d2b2dd5ec8635e2244ec2a245d9177d0fcb80b82:0
- value
- 546320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2afe4bbd07f86d5de261aa77f4322439eb107c06 OP_EQUAL
- address
- 35cLwPMdzzG6KS38MaK7b7FnyNjUqxASye